当前位置: 首页  >  教程资讯
php开发安卓系统源码,探索PHP开发安卓系统源码的奥秘
  • 时间:2025-05-06 06:57:26
  • 浏览:

你有没有想过,用PHP这样的服务器端脚本语言,也能开发出安卓系统的源码呢?听起来是不是有点不可思议?别急,今天就来带你一探究竟,揭开PHP开发安卓系统源码的神秘面纱!

PHP:服务器端的“小宇宙”

PHP,作为一款历史悠久的服务器端脚本语言,一直以其简洁、高效、易学等特点,深受广大开发者的喜爱。它擅长处理网页逻辑、数据库交互,是构建动态网站的不二之选。PHP的舞台似乎一直局限于服务器端,那么,它如何与安卓系统源码扯上关系呢?

PHP与安卓:跨界合作的火花

其实,PHP与安卓系统源码的合作并非空穴来风。随着移动互联网的快速发展,越来越多的开发者开始尝试将PHP的强大功能引入到移动应用开发中。以下是一些将PHP与安卓系统源码结合的常见场景:

1. 后端服务:PHP可以轻松地搭建一个强大的后端服务,为安卓应用提供数据支持。例如,用户信息、商品信息、新闻资讯等,都可以通过PHP后端进行管理。

2. API接口:PHP可以开发一系列API接口,供安卓应用调用。这样,安卓应用就可以通过这些接口,实现数据的增删改查、用户认证等功能。

3. 云存储:PHP可以与云存储服务(如阿里云、腾讯云等)结合,为安卓应用提供数据存储、备份等功能。

4. 消息推送:PHP可以开发消息推送服务,为安卓应用实现实时消息通知、推送等功能。

开发安卓系统源码的步骤

那么,如何使用PHP开发安卓系统源码呢?以下是一些基本步骤:

1. 搭建PHP开发环境:首先,需要在本地电脑上搭建PHP开发环境,包括安装PHP解释器、数据库(如MySQL)、Web服务器(如Apache)等。

2. 开发后端服务:使用PHP开发后端服务,实现数据管理、API接口等功能。

3. 开发安卓客户端:使用Java或Kotlin等安卓开发语言,开发安卓客户端应用程序。

4. 集成PHP后端服务:将安卓客户端与PHP后端服务进行集成,实现数据交互、功能调用等。

5. 测试与优化:对开发完成的安卓应用程序进行测试,确保其稳定性和性能。如有需要,对代码进行优化。

案例分析:基于PHP的安卓论坛类源码网站

以下是一个基于PHP的安卓论坛类源码网站的案例分析:

该网站使用PHP编程语言构建,实现了用户注册、登录、发帖、回帖、搜索、私信等功能。它依赖于PHP环境运行,并与MySQL数据库配合,用于存储用户信息、帖子内容等数据。

该网站的核心技术包括:

1. PHP基础语法:变量、数据类型、控制结构、函数等。

2. PHP面向对象编程:类、对象、属性、方法、继承、多态等。

3. PHP与数据库交互:使用MySQLi或PDO扩展进行SQL查询、事务处理、预处理语句等。

4. PHP会话和cookies:用于用户状态管理。

5. PHP错误和异常处理:如何捕获和处理运行时错误。

通过这个案例,我们可以看到,PHP在开发安卓系统源码方面具有很大的潜力。

PHP与安卓系统源码的结合,为开发者带来了新的思路和可能性。虽然PHP并非安卓开发的主流语言,但其在后端服务、API接口、云存储、消息推送等方面的优势,使其在移动应用开发中仍具有不可忽视的地位。相信在未来的发展中,PHP与安卓系统源码的合作将更加紧密,为移动互联网带来更多创新和惊喜。


相关推荐